Aluta Continua Limpopo!
20 May 2014
The SACP Limpopo Province Officials held a meeting on Sunday, 18th May 2014. The SACP National Organiser Mhlekwa Nxumalo who is visiting the province also formed part of the meeting. The focus of the meeting was to appraise the SACPs role, performance and impact during the recent election campaign.
Firstly, the SACP salutes the workers, the rural and the urbanised working class for their overwhelming vote for the ANC and the Alliance.
This demonstrated beyond doubt that the ANC, COSATU and SACP are not only popular but also rooted among the workers and the rural masses of Limpopo Province. Despite failed sabotage of the ANC and the Alliance election campaign by a wealthy clique of demagogues characterised by crass materialism and opulence within the NUMSA, our workers supported the ANC and the Alliance campaign massively and decisively especially in Limpopo Province.
The SACP is humbled by the centrality of many a communist cadre who poured out their all and remain a live wire of the ANC and the Alliance election campaign in Limpopo Province. During the election campaign the SACPs Red Brigades have proven that the duty of communists in taking the responsibility for the national democratic revolution in the current phase of radical socio-economic transformation, which is rabidly contested by the bourgeoisie who are the class enemy of the working class, is to remain deeply rooted among the workers in all sites of struggle. The election campaign was one such site of struggle that the SACP Red Brigades took seriously.
Secondly, the SACP Limpopo Province decided to consolidate problems raised by communities and households visited during door to door campaign. The consolidation will be done on area and community specific approach. Thereafter, these will essentially be integrated into our South African Road to Socialism programme (SARS) Thus lay the basis for continuum of our programmes post elections period.
The SACPs observation during the election campaign is that there already exists solution to most of the problems raised by the working class communities. What is urgently required is a committed and incorruptible cadre of public service and officials in the provincial and local government spheres of governance to realise a speedy provisioning of quality services for the working class communities as a matter of priority.
The SACP will ensure and strengthen efforts for adequate responses to the problems as raised by working within the working class communities jointly with our Alliance partners. This forms part of SACPs approach of not shying away from participating in legislative processes while at the same time occupying the streets picketing and marching.
The significance of unity of outlook among the ANC, COSATU and SACP is the guarantor for the fulfilment of our election manifesto. However this unity will require joint practical work on the ground to rebuild the province from the ashes of despair and uplift the socio economic conditions of the working class.
This will among other things require decisive action to root out all counter-revolutionary tendencies that are found within some municipalities, provincial departments, not excluding the PECs, RECs and BEC structures of the movement who are actively collaborating with the so-called Economic Freedom Fighters in syphoning public resources to sponsor counter-revolutionary causes.
In this connection, the next campaigns of the SACP Limpopo Province will focus on eradicating corruption and maladministration in all municipalities and provincial departments before 2016.
The SACP Limpopo Province will immediately embark on campaigns for the removal of those public representatives in municipalities and provincial departments who are compromising the fight against corruption and maladministration.
"As the SACP our support for the ANC is not a blank cheque " meaning that Aluta Continua in Limpopo Province for decisive and radical socio-economic transformation in the interest of the rural masses and the working class. This will be a grand way of recognising working class electoral support!
The SACP Limpopo Province will during the month of May launch the Financial Services Sector Campaign for the transformation of the financial sector, organise Moses Kotane commemorative activities across the province and also begin to prepare for the district congresses and 2016 Local Government Elections.
